腾讯云VPS嵌套虚拟,如何实现容器化部署

2025-05-20 服务器新闻 阅读 5
󦘖

卡尔云官网

www.kaeryun.com

复制打开官网

在现代云计算时代,容器化部署已经成为应用开发和部署的重要趋势,容器化技术通过将应用程序和其依赖的环境打包成一个独立的实体,可以实现资源的高效利用和快速部署,而嵌套虚拟(Nested Virtualization)则是 containerization(容器化)技术的进一步升级,它允许在一个容器内运行另一个容器,从而实现资源的深度共享和优化配置。

腾讯云VPS嵌套虚拟,如何实现容器化部署

本文将详细讲解如何在腾讯云VPS上实现嵌套虚拟,帮助您更好地理解这一技术,并掌握其实现方法。


什么是嵌套虚拟?

嵌套虚拟是指在一个容器内运行另一个容器,使得这两个容器可以共享资源,如CPU、内存、存储和网络资源,这种设计可以实现资源的深度共享,从而提高资源利用率和应用性能。

在嵌套虚拟中,内层容器负责运行核心业务逻辑,而外层容器则负责资源管理、网络配置和环境隔离,这种设计可以有效隔离不同应用之间的干扰,同时优化资源使用效率。


嵌套虚拟的核心概念

嵌套虚拟的核心思想是通过容器化技术实现资源的深度共享,以下是嵌套虚拟的一些关键概念:

  1. 容器(Container):容器是容器化技术的基本单位,它包含应用程序的代码、依赖项和运行时环境。
  2. 宿主容器(Host Container):宿主容器负责运行嵌套虚拟的逻辑,提供资源管理、网络配置和容器隔离。
  3. 内层容器(Nested Container):内层容器是被嵌套在宿主容器中的容器,负责运行核心业务逻辑。
  4. 资源隔离(Resource Isolation):嵌套虚拟通过资源隔离,确保内层容器和宿主容器之间资源不干扰,同时提高资源利用率。

腾讯云VPS嵌套虚拟的实现步骤

要实现腾讯云VPS嵌套虚拟,需要按照以下步骤操作:

准备环境

确保您的腾讯云VPS已经安装了必要的容器化工具,如Docker和Kubernetes,如果尚未安装,可以按照腾讯云的官方文档进行安装。

创建宿主容器

宿主容器负责运行嵌套虚拟的逻辑,通常是一个管理容器,以下是创建宿主容器的命令:

# 安装Docker和Kubernetes
# 安装完成后,启动Docker服务
# 在Docker容器中运行宿主容器
docker run -d -e KUBERNETES_API_URL=http://127.0.0.1:8080 -e KUBERNETES_INsecure=1 -p 8080:4040 -p 8081:4041 -p 8443:4444 kubernetserver

创建内层容器

内层容器是被嵌套在宿主容器中的容器,负责运行核心业务逻辑,以下是创建内层容器的命令:

# 在宿主容器中运行内层容器
docker run -d -m -e KUBERNETES references=kubernetserver:1.24.0 -e KUBERNETES_INsecure=1 -p 8080:4040 -p 8081:4041 -p 8443:4444 dockerCMD

配置内层容器

在内层容器中,您需要配置容器化应用的依赖项和运行时环境,如果您的应用依赖于某个开源项目,可以在宿主容器中将该开源项目的镜像添加到内层容器的Dockerfile中。

测试嵌套虚拟

在配置完成后,您可以使用Docker CLI命令启动内层容器并进行测试。

docker exec -it --namespace app dockerCMD

嵌套虚拟的优势

嵌套虚拟在云计算环境中具有以下优势:

  1. 资源利用率:通过资源隔离,嵌套虚拟可以最大限度地利用资源,减少资源浪费。
  2. 扩展性:嵌套虚拟支持动态扩展,可以根据业务需求调整资源分配。
  3. 安全性:通过容器化技术,嵌套虚拟可以实现应用的深度隔离和安全控制。
  4. 管理便捷:嵌套虚拟通过容器化技术简化了应用的部署和管理流程。

嵌套虚拟的潜在问题

尽管嵌套虚拟具有许多优势,但在实际应用中也存在一些潜在问题:

  1. 资源竞争:如果内层容器和宿主容器资源竞争激烈,可能会导致资源分配不均。
  2. 网络延迟:嵌套虚拟的网络设计可能会增加网络延迟,影响应用性能。
  3. 配置复杂性:嵌套虚拟的配置需要一定的技术背景,对于非专业人士来说可能会有一定的难度。

嵌套虚拟是一种强大的容器化技术,通过资源隔离和共享,可以显著提高资源利用率和应用性能,在腾讯云VPS上实现嵌套虚拟,需要按照一定的步骤配置宿主容器和内层容器,并注意潜在的问题,通过嵌套虚拟,您可以更高效地部署和管理复杂的云计算应用,从而提升整体业务的性能和稳定性。

󦘖

卡尔云官网

www.kaeryun.com

复制打开官网

相关推荐

  • 微服务器,现代计算世界的轻量级革命

    {卡尔云官网 www.kaeryun.com}在当今快速发展的数字时代,服务器作为支撑现代互联网和数字化转型的核心基础设施,其重要性不言而喻,传统服务器的高功耗、高成本和高资源消耗已经难以满足现代计算需求,微服务器的出现,标志着一场全新的计算范式革命。 微服务器的...

    0服务器新闻2025-10-13
  • 浙江一区都有哪些服务器服务提供商?带 you 全面解析

    {卡尔云官网 www.kaeryun.com}好,我现在需要回答用户的问题:“浙江一区都有什么服务器”,用户希望我以知乎风格,结合专业知识,用大白话写一篇不少于1000字的文章,并且标题要吸引人,还要符合SEO优化,突出关键词。 我得明确用户的问题是什么,他们可能...

    1服务器新闻2025-10-13
  • cf新手选什么服务器

    {卡尔云官网 www.kaeryun.com}好,我现在要帮一个新手选择合适的云服务器,我对这方面还不是很了解,得先理清楚有哪些因素需要考虑。 我需要明确自己的使用场景,我是个人用户还是企业用户?如果是个人,可能主要是运行一些简单的应用,比如博客或者在线工具,如果...

    1服务器新闻2025-10-13
  • 刀剑神域选什么服务器好?新手必看指南

    {卡尔云官网 www.kaeryun.com}好,用户问的是《刀剑神域选什么服务器好》,我得分析一下用户的需求,可能是一个游戏的新手或者老玩家,想了解如何选择适合自己玩的服务器,提升游戏体验。 我需要了解刀剑神域这款游戏的基本情况,游戏类型是MMORPG,画面精美...

    0服务器新闻2025-10-13
  • 打游戏服务器不稳怎么办?

    {卡尔云官网 www.kaeryun.com}好,我现在需要帮用户解答“打游戏服务器不稳怎么办”这个问题,用户希望我以知乎风格,结合专业知识,用大白话写一篇至少1000字的文章,并且符合SEO优化,突出关键词。 我得理解用户的问题,他们可能是在玩一款游戏,遇到了服...

    1服务器新闻2025-10-13
  • 游戏服务器为什么要维护?从技术角度解析游戏平台的运营之道

    {卡尔云官网 www.kaeryun.com}在游戏行业发展迅速的今天,游戏服务器的维护已成为一个不容忽视的重要环节,无论是像《王者荣耀》这样拥有庞大用户基础的游戏平台,还是普通的游戏开发者,都需要对服务器进行定期维护,这种维护不仅仅是技术层面的优化,更是对玩家体验和游...

    1服务器新闻2025-10-13
  • VPS丢包率高怎么办?这些方法让你轻松应对网络波动

    {卡尔云官网 www.kaeryun.com}在VPS服务器上运行网站,遇到丢包率高的问题确实让人头疼,丢包率高意味着数据传输不稳定,网站加载变慢,用户体验大打折扣,如何解决VPS丢包率高的问题呢?别担心,下面我来为你详细分析。 丢包率高是什么意思? 丢包率是指...

    1服务器新闻2025-10-13
  • 腾讯服务器是什么样子?

    {卡尔云官网 www.kaeryun.com}好,我现在需要回答用户的问题:“腾讯服务器是什么样子”,用户希望我以知乎风格,结合专业知识,用大白话写一篇至少1000字的文章,并且优化SEO关键词。 我得理解用户的问题,他们可能对腾讯服务器不太了解,想知道它的样子和...

    1服务器新闻2025-10-13
  • 魔兽世界游戏服务器选择指南,如何选择流畅的服务器?

    {卡尔云官网 www.kaeryun.com}嗯,用户问魔兽世界什么服务器流畅,这应该是想玩游戏的时候选择一个稳定的服务器,我得考虑用户可能是什么身份,可能是个游戏爱好者,或者是刚加入游戏的新玩家,想了解如何选择服务器。 我需要分析他们的需求,他们可能对游戏服务器...

    1服务器新闻2025-10-13
  • 未通过服务器验证是什么?原因及解决方法

    {卡尔云官网 www.kaeryun.com}嗯,用户问的是“未通过服务器验证是什么”,我得理解这个问题,用户可能是一个刚开始接触网络安全的新手,或者遇到了相关问题,想要了解具体情况。 我应该先解释什么是服务器验证,然后说明为什么会出现未通过的情况,可能需要举几个...

    1服务器新闻2025-10-13

微信号复制成功

打开微信,点击右上角"+"号,添加朋友,粘贴微信号,搜索即可!